Background technique
Marigold (Tagetes erecta L) is composite family Tagetes annual herb plant.Capitulum Dan Sheng;Tongue Shape Hua Huangse or dark is orange;Tubular flower corolla yellow.The month at florescence 7-9.
Lutein ester (1.5-2.9 ‰, W/DW) rich in marigold flower.Lutein ester can after extraction and saponification Form free xanthophyll.The key technology that lutein is prepared from marigold flower is lutein ester extraction.The marigold flower middle period Flavine ester is present in the organelle in petal cell.The film of cell wall and organelle hinders extraction solvent and lutein ester Contact, leads to the low of extraction efficiency.

The present invention also provides the methods of Carotenoids extraction, include the following steps:
1) above-mentioned fresh marigold flower inorganic agent is dissolved in the sucrose water of 3w/w% concentration, is placed at room temperature for 3 hours, wherein Fresh marigold flower inorganic agent and the amount ratio of sucrose water are 1g:0.3L;
2) fresh marigold flower inorganic agent is uniformly sprayed on fresh marigold flower surface according to the dosage of 6mL/kg, be compacted, it is close Envelope causes anaerobic environment, ferments 12 days, controls 15-45 DEG C of temperature;
3) tunning pH value is measured, behind pH≤3.2, extrusion dehydration, 60 DEG C of heated-air dryings 30 minutes to water content≤ 16%, obtain processed dried marigold flower;
In fermentation process, microorganism produces acid, and the tunning pH upper limit is 3.2.
4) n-hexane is added according to the amount that n-hexane 3-5L is added in 1kg in dried marigold flower, static extracting 30 divides at room temperature Clock collects extract liquor;
5) vacuum rotating drying instrument is used, concentrated extract is to no distillate under the conditions of 45 DEG C, -0.06MPa, 30rpm.
Fresh marigold flower inorganic agent provided by the invention belong to it is a kind of for handling the special product of fresh marigold flower, by (1) microorganism, (2) enzyme preparation and (3) antioxidant three parts form.The main purpose used is to improve to extract from marigold flower The extraction efficiency for taking carotenoids compound (predominantly lutein ester and zeaxanthin ester), using provided by the invention ten thousand Longevity chrysanthemum fresh flower inorganic agent can make extraction carotenoids compound extraction efficiency in marigold flower improve 40%.
Its mechanism of action includes:
(1) group synthase (including cellulase, pectase and protease) degradation Petal cell to the maximum extent is applied Wall, cell membrane and intracellular carotenoid-protein complex make between carotenoid molecule and extraction solvent molecule Reach maximum contact, to improve extraction efficiency.
(2) simultaneously, using enzymolysis product, the fermentation of acid-producing microorganisms is carried out, reduces the pH value of system.It is broken in eucaryotic cell structure After bad, effectively inhibit the growth of other microorganisms.
(3) in above process, using antioxidant of the free radical as the mechanism of action is quenched, class is reduced to the maximum extent The loss of carrotene.

Embodiment 1
Selecting marigold (Tagetes erecta L) fresh flower that lutein ester content is 0.23 ‰ (W/FW) is test sample. Implementation steps are as follows:
(1) 100 kilograms of fresh marigold flower are picked, is divided into 2 parts, 50 kilograms every part, portion is inorganic agent group, another For control sample group.
(2) inorganic agent is prepared
It is formulated by table 1 and prepares inorganic agent
1 treatment agent formula of table
Above-mentioned material is mixed according to formula ratio.
(3) it takes 1g inorganic agent to be dissolved in the sucrose water of 300mL 3% (W/W), places 3 hours at room temperature.
(4) processing agent solution is uniformly sprayed on to 50 kilograms of fresh marigold flower surfaces of inorganic agent group.
(5) it is compacted, sealing causes anaerobic condition.
(6) it ferments 12 days, 42 DEG C of temperature is controlled during fermentation.
(7) behind tunning pH≤3.2;
(8) extrusion dehydration.
(9) 60 DEG C of heated-air dryings 30 minutes are to water content≤16%.
(10) measurement obtains 5.4 kilograms of processed dried flowers.
(11) static extracting 30 minutes at room temperature in 20 liters of n-hexanes.
(12) extract liquor I is collected.
(13) 10L vacuum rotating drying instrument is used, concentrated extract to nothing distillates under the conditions of 45 DEG C, -0.06MPa, 30rpm Object.
(14) weight of concentrate is measured.
(15) total carotinoid content analysis in extract is concentrated
A certain amount of concentrate is taken, the hexane solution of concentrate is prepared, makes solution in the light absorption value of maximum absorption wavelength Between 0.2 to 0.3.
The absorption spectrum that concentrate hexane solution is measured on ultraviolet-visible spectrophotometer, in maximum absorption wave Its light absorption value is measured at long (445nm), according to Lambert-Beer's law, the dense of wherein total carotinoid is calculated according to the following formula Degree:
X=(A × y)/(A1%1cm × 100) (1)
Wherein:
Total carotinoid quantity (gram) contained in x=sample
The volume (milliliter) of y=sample solution
The light absorption value of A=sample
A1%1cm=absorptivity, for the theoretical absorption of 1% (W/V) concentration solute in the long cuvette of 1 centimeter optical path Value.Here, adopted value is 2200.
(16) residue is collected.Step (11) to (15) are repeated, the total carotinoid content in extract liquor II, III is measured, Until the light absorption value of extract liquor is 0, reaches complete extraction, be computed using extractant n-hexane 60L.
(17) step (2) to (16) are pressed, fermentation process is carried out to control sample.Step (2) is replaced extremely with 300mL distilled water (3) resulting processing agent solution.The total carotinoid content in extract liquor I, II, III, IV and V is measured, until extract liquor Light absorption value is 0, accomplishes to extract completely, is computed using extractant n-hexane 100L.
(18) inorganic agent is shown in shown in Figure 1A (inorganic agent group) and Figure 1B (control group) with the UV-VIS spectrum for compareing extract.
(19) inorganic agent with compare total carotinoid comparision contents in extract, be detailed in Fig. 2A (inorganic agent group) and Fig. 2 B Shown in (control group).Wherein, I, II, III and I, II, III, IV, V respectively represent inorganic agent group first pass, second time, third time Extraction and control sample group first pass, second time, third time, the 4th time, the 5th time extract liquor extracted.
(20) total carotinoid total yield compares
Inorganic agent extract (I+II+III) total carotinoid total yield: 11.43 grams/50 kilograms.
Control extract (I+II+III+IV+V) total carotinoid total yield: 11.07 grams/50 kilograms.
From Fig. 2A as can be seen that under the premise of obtaining identical total carotinoid total yield, the present invention is used to mention In the group of the fresh marigold flower inorganic agent of confession, by twice extraction just substantially by the carotenoid in fresh marigold flower it is complete It extracts, third time is then to ensure that carotenoid therein extracts completely really.And as can be seen that with water in Fig. 2 B In group instead of fresh marigold flower inorganic agent, then need by four times ability substantially by the carotenoid in fresh marigold flower It extracts completely, is then to ensure that carotenoid therein extracts completely really the 5th time.That is, having used this Inventing can mention completely the carotenoid in longevity chrysanthemum fresh flower for most three times in the group of the fresh marigold flower inorganic agent provided It takes out, the control sample group than not using reduces the usage amount of Extraction solvent up to 40%, reduces and extracts total time, is promoted Extraction efficiency, accordingly also reduces the cost of extraction.
